Sorry, aber ich hab eine ziemlich blöde Frage. Kann mir jemand sagen, ob ich Daten, die bereits in Zope eingepflegt sind, relativ einfach in eine mysql Datenbank überführen kann? Ich hab keine Ahnung von Zope, aber Daten, die da bereits eingepflegt wurden, und nun wieder raus sollen.
Für einen Tipp wäre ich sehr dankbar
Vanessa
Anfängerinnenfrage zu zope
-
vanessa -
5. Juli 2007 um 12:41
-
-
Wenn du daran denkst, die Attribute wie Titel, Description, etc. in mySQl abzulegen: nein - denn Zope speichert Objekte und mySQL (im Normalfall) reine Daten.
Für solche Aufgaben muss ein Export-Script erstellt werden, welches die Objekte quasi in reine Daten (vermutlich die Werte der Attribute) umwandelt und in die mySQL schreibt.Anderenfalls wäre Zope aber in der Lage seine Objekte statt in der ZODB auch in einer mySQL zu speichern. Dann jedoch landen in den mySQL-Tabellen binäre Daten, die man nicht direkt lesen kann.
Also nichts triviales. sry.
Torty
-
Hallo Torty,
vielen Dank für die schnelle Antwort.
Hhm, damit ich mich nochmal vergewissere. Es ist so, das die Texte, die Grafiken die Navigation und die Styles usw. eigentlich fertig in zope eingepflegt wurden.
Nun soll ein CMS (php Mysql) benutzt werden, was leichter handhabbar ist von der Administrator- seite aber au.ch von der Benutzerseite. Ich hab da keine Ahnung und sehe nur die Daten im viewbereich von Zope.
Gruß Vanessa -
Das wäre dann ein Job (wenn überhaupt) für ein Script, welches die Inhalte vom Zope auf das neue CMS überträgt. Ich glaube aber fast, dass man dann per Hand schneller wäre.
Ich kann mich irren, aber ich glaube da bist du schneller es per Hand zu übertragen.Torty
-
Guten Morgen ,
das hatte ich bei meinem Kenntnisstand schon vermutet
vielen Dank noch mal für deine Antwort und schöne Ferien
Vanessa